Description

🚀 This role offers hybrid working, requiring candidates within commuting distance of Bridgwater or open to relocation support.
You will oversee pressure systems compliance and structural integrity across defined project scopes and act as the technical authority, supporting delivery, safety case alignment, and regulatory engagement.

🔧Ensure pressure systems compliance requirements are defined, maintained, and implemented effectively
📘Support structural integrity safety case development across allocated project scope
⚖️Make technical decisions on compliance issues, escalating where necessary appropriately
🤝Interface with project managers, regulators, and supply chain partners regularly
📊Ensure policies, processes, and contracts meet compliance and quality requirements
🏗️Support delivery of pressure equipment manufacture, installation, and conformity activities
🧩Act as single point of contact for pressure compliance within scope
📢Provide technical guidance and coaching to internal teams and suppliers
🔍Monitor third-party delivery to ensure compliance with project expectations
🛠️Support wider project needs based on experience and business requirements

Nuclear experience is not essential, but is of course welcome. If you have worked within a highly regulated environment, your skills and approach are highly transferable and of strong interest to us.

We also recognise that the perfect candidate rarely exists. If you feel you meet around 80% of the criteria and are motivated to develop further, we would strongly encourage you to apply

🎓Degree in Mechanical Engineering or related engineering discipline
📜Knowledge of pressure systems regulations and structural integrity requirements
⚙️Experience with RCC-M or ASME pressure equipment design codes
🏭Background in power generation, nuclear, oil and gas, or petrochemical sectors
🔗Experience working within multidisciplinary project environments
📋Understanding of conformity assessment, manufacturing, and installation processes
🧠Ability to make technical decisions and manage compliance responsibilities
📣Experience engaging with regulators and supply chain stakeholders
🛠️Working knowledge of UK regulatory requirements is advantageous
🏅Chartered status or working towards chartership with relevant institution
